Ingredients
- 16 oz salted peanuts — add crunch and that irresistible salty contrast.
- 16 oz unsalted peanuts — balance the salt and give structure to the candy.
- 2 (12 oz) bags semi-sweet chocolate chips — provide rich chocolate depth.
- 2 (10 oz) bags peanut butter chips — bring creamy, nutty sweetness.
- 2 (10 oz) bags white chocolate chips or wafers — add smooth sweetness and festive color.
- Christmas sprinkles — for a fun, festive finish.
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Layer the Ingredients
Add both the salted and unsalted peanuts to the bottom of your slow cooker. Stir lightly so they’re evenly mixed.
Step 2: Add the Chocolate
Layer the semi-sweet chocolate chips, peanut butter chips, and white chocolate chips on top of the peanuts. Do not stir yet.
Step 3: Slow Cook Until Melted
Cover and cook on LOW for about 2 hours, stirring gently every 30 minutes until everything is fully melted and smooth.
Step 4: Stir Until Glossy
Once melted, stir thoroughly until the peanuts are completely coated and the mixture looks glossy and evenly combined.
Step 5: Scoop and Set
Using a spoon, drop clusters onto parchment-lined baking sheets. Immediately sprinkle with Christmas sprinkles before the chocolate sets.
Step 6: Let Harden
Allow the candy to set at room temperature for 1–2 hours or refrigerate for 30 minutes until firm.
Pro Tips for Perfect Christmas Crack
- Use good-quality chocolate chips for the smoothest melt.
- Always melt on LOW to avoid scorching the chocolate.
- Line your trays with parchment or silicone mats for easy removal.
- For extra flavor, add a pinch of flaky sea salt on top.
- Store in an airtight container to keep fresh and snappy.
Fun Variations
- Swap peanuts for cashews or almonds.
- Add crushed pretzels for extra crunch.
- Mix in mini marshmallows or toffee bits.
- Drizzle with dark chocolate for a dramatic finish.
